Hi @Pebbleridge,
You can try these troubleshooting steps:
- Press on settings > Apps > LiveTV & CatchUp > Uninstall updates, Force Stop.
- Press Home > LiveTV & CatchUp > Apps > BBC iPlayer
- Make sure that your TV is on the latest update
If the issue remains, the final option is performing a factory reset: https://www.sony.co.uk/electronics/support/articles/00274122?link-header

Thanks for your suggestions, which are "similar" to the advice I received from Sony technical support.
I tried everything but one thing that Sony suggested I hadn't tried and that was to physically unplug the TV for a few minutes.
Base on their advice but expanding it to incorporate my thoughts (it might be network related, even though the TV said the Internet was OK) I also physically unplugged my Broad band, router and network switch.
I turned everything back on and it iPlayer is now working again.
So fingers crossed I have now resolved the issue.
